High-Performance Computing with CUDA

CUDA is a parallel computing platform and API developed by NVIDIA. It enables developers to utilize the processing power of NVIDIA’s GPUs for general-purpose computation. This technology accelerates computationally intensive tasks like simulations, data analysis, and machine learning. Tabnine AI

Tabnine focuses heavily on privacy and local model training, allowing organizations to train the AI on their private, proprietary codebases without sending data to external servers. While its chat interface is functional, its true power lies in its highly accurate, context-aware code completion suggestions that adapt precisely to an organization's unique coding style and internal libraries.
